Homerton Station takes commuter convenience seriously with a range of well-thought-out amenities. Although there's no waiting room or seating area, step-free access spans the entire station, ensuring inclusivity for everyone. Ticket buyers will find the process smooth, with machines available and opening hours stretching from early morning to the evening on weekdays, slightly reduced over the weekend. For those needing to collect tickets purchased online, the accessible machines make it an easy task. While there's no provision for smartcard issuance or validation, the induction loop and ramp for train access are thoughtful inclusions for those needing additional assistance.
Security is well handled at Homerton station with CCTV cameras in place. For assistance, there's a help point available, and customer support can be reached at 0845 601 4867 for any immediate concerns. Although luggage storage isn't available, keep in mind the resourceful staff are always ready to assist. Navigating to or from Homerton station offers various travel links to consider. Rail replacement services provide eastbound access to Stratford from Bus Stop L and westbound connectivity to Camden Road through Bus Stop M. For those seeking taxis, a convenient minicab office is just across the street from the station. Adderley Park station ensures travel convenience with ticket machines available for those who purchase tickets online. While there is no dedicated ticket office on Mondays, staff presence is available on most days. Travelers can expect helpful departure screens and announcements to stay updated about their journey. Although the station lacks fully accessible facilities, step-free access is partially available, and ramps can be provided for train access upon request.
The station doesn’t currently offer some amenities like refreshment facilities, but its strategic location means there's always something nearby in Birmingham to quench your thirst or satisfy any snack cravings. While toilets and baby changing facilities are also unavailable, the station is under CCTV surveillance, adding a layer of security for travelers and their properties. For bikers, a small cycling storage area is present, albeit unsheltered.
Adderley Park is not just about train travel. It integrates seamlessly with other local transport options, offering easier navigation around the bustling city of Birmingham and beyond. In the case of rail service disruptions, rail replacement vehicles board from Bordesley Green Road, right outside the station entrance. Local bus services by West Midlands buses provide frequent and robust connections throughout the city. For those looking to travel comfortably without a personal ride, taxis are readily available with local companies like Embassy and TOA, which can be contacted for services directly to your next destination.
